2

我将 nativeScript、@angular/cli 和 @nativescript/schematics 更新为最新的稳定版本。生成了一个新项目:

ng 新端口 --collection=@nativescript/schematics --shared --style=scss --prefix=port

其次是

tns 运行 ios --bundle

错误:

***** Fatal JavaScript exception - application has been terminated. *****
Native stack trace:
1   0x10da0702e NativeScript::reportFatalErrorBeforeShutdown(JSC::ExecState*, JSC::Exception*, bool)
2   0x10da58f94 -[TNSRuntime executeModule:referredBy:]
3   0x10d2f50b3 main
4   0x7fff51a231fd start
5   0x1
JavaScript stack trace:
file: node_modules/@nativescript/angular/__ivy_ngcc__/zone-js/dist/zone-nativescript.js:32:0
at file: node_modules/@nativescript/angular/__ivy_ngcc__/zone-js/dist/zone-nativescript.js:645:1
at file: node_modules/@nativescript/angular/__ivy_ngcc__/zone-js/dist/zone-nativescript.js:9:61
at file: node_modules/@nativescript/angular/__ivy_ngcc__/zone-js/dist/zone-nativescript.js:12:1
at ../node_modules/@nativescript/angular/__ivy_ngcc__/zone-js/dist/zone-nativescript.js(file:///app/vendor.js:103073:34)
at __webpack_require__(file: src/webpack/bootstrap:752:0)
at fn(file: src/webpack/bootstrap:120:0)
at file: node_modules/@nativescript/angular/__ivy_ngcc__/platform-common.js:6:8
at ../node_modules/@nativescript/angular/__ivy_ngcc__/platform-common.js(file:///app/vendor.js:97913:34)
at __webpack_require__(file: src/webpack/bootstrap:752:0)
at fn(file: src/webpack/bootstrap:120:0)
at ../node_modules/@nativescript/angular/__ivy_ngcc__/index.js(file: node_modules/@nativescript/angular/__ivy_ngcc__/index.js:6:17)
at __webpack_require__(file: src/webpack/bootstrap:752:0)
at fn(file: src/webpack/bootstrap:120:0)
at ./app/app.module.tns.ts(file: src/app/app.module.tns.ts:1:0)
at __webpack_require__(file: src/webpack/bootstrap:752:0)
at fn(file: src/webpack/bootstrap:120:0)
at file:///app/bundle.js:240:96
at ./main.tns.ts(file:///app/bundle.js:298:34)
at __webpack_require__(fi<…&gt;
JavaScript error:
file: node_modules/@nativescript/angular/__ivy_ngcc__/zone-js/dist/zone-nativescript.js:32:0: JS ERROR Error: Zone already loaded.
(CoreFoundation) *** Terminating app due to uncaught exception 'NativeScript encountered a fatal error: Error: Zone already loaded
4

1 回答 1

0

nativescript angular9 和 ivy 的许多问题。但要修复此错误,只需使用zone.js 0.9.1

于 2020-07-10T14:26:16.093 回答